Charters were always a staple of this VA in the past. And I'm sure management would not be opposed to releasing new ones.

The problem is, sometimes management is busy up to their armpits in the day to day running of the airline. Sometimes, they just don't have the time to create, plan and implement such a thing. Keep in mind, these guys have real lives and real demands on their time...

My suggestion? If you have a great charter idea, put a package together and submit it to management for approval. I'll give you an example:

When BC Ferries "Queen of the North" sank, I put together a charter from Pitt Meadows up the sunshine coast to service the islands that were somewhat stranded now that their ferry sank. Amphibious float planes where used. I included the webpages explaining the flight and the mission (much like what our multi page looks like). Included scenery that added float plane docks at the islands in question (need somewhere to go, right)? and had a couple float planes painted up and included in the package. Keep in mind that if you include scenery and aircraft, you will likely have to include versions for both FS9 and FSX so everyone in the va can participate.

As you can see, I did all the leg work for the project. All management had to do was approve it and hit the upload button. You'll find that if you participate in this way, you're FAR more likely to see your idea come to pass! In fact, CVA has always strongly encouraged such participation from it's members! It helps keep the airline fresh and interesting.

On the other hand, if your idea is simply "Hey! We should do such-and-such" but you leave it up to someone ELSE to do all the work.... Well, you might be waiting a loooonnnngggg time for your charter....
